Professional SQL Server 2000 Programming provides a comprehensive guide to programming with SQL Server 2000, from a complete tutorial on Transact–SQL to an in–depth discussion of new features, such as indexed views, user–defined functions, and the wealth of new SQL Server features to support XML. Whether you’re coming to SQL Server 2000 from another relational database management system, upgrading your existing system, or perhaps want to add programming skills to your DBA knowledge, you’ll find what you need in this book to come to grips with SQL Server 2000 development.
Who is this book for:
This book is aimed at the SQL Server developer who wants to make the most out of the new features of SQL Server 2000. No knowledge of SQL Server is assumed, although in order to follow this book, you do need to have an understanding of programming basics such as variables, data types, and procedural programming. Database administration is also covered but only insofar as it affects the SQL Server developer.
